a) ISO 7380-2 specifies the standard for hexagon socket button head screws with collar. Generic hexalobular socket (6 lobe) is another common alternative used in various applications.
b) This screw features an extended cylindrical tip, known as a dog point, at the end of the threaded portion, enabling precise alignment and positioning in mating components.
a) This bolt features an external hexalobular socket with a small flange, and is designed for applications requiring a high torque transfer with reduced risk of cam-out.
b) The star-shaped head allows for great torque transfer by distributing the load more evenly across the drive, compared to traditional drive systems like Phillips, Pozi or slotted.
a) The screw head features a hexalobular socket, often referred to by the generic name “6 lobe”
b) The flat underside of the pan head distributes clamping force over a larger area compared to countersunk or round head screws.
c) Although there may be minor differences in dimensional tolerances or thread requirements, both DIN 7985 (German standard) and ISO 14583 (international standard) specify pan head screws.
